Résumé
This book will help your middle school student develop the math skills needed to succeed in the classroom and on standardized tests. The user-friendly, full-color pages are filled to the brim with engaging activities for maximum educational value. The book includes easy-to-follow instructions, helpful examples, and tons of practice problems to help students master each concept, sharpen their problem-solving skills, and build confidence.
Features Include : - A guide that outlines national standards for Grade 7 ; - Concise lessons combined with extensive practice ; - A pretest to help identify areas where students need more work ; - End-of-unit tests to measure students' progress ; - A helpful glossary of key terms used in the book ; - More than 1,000 math problems with answers.

Topics Covered : - Mathematical operations and number properties ; - Negative numbers and absolute value ; - Solving problems with rational numbers ; - Ratios and proportions ; - Percent and percent change ; - Graphing relationships and unit rates ; - Roots and exponents ; - Scientific notation ; - Solving equations and inequalities ; - Customary and metric units of measure, including conversions ; - Data presentation ; - Statistics and probability ; - Constructing and analyzing geometric figures ; - Solving problems involving angle measure, area, surface area, and volume.
